Miroslav Stefanov Kirov is a Bulgarian freestyle wrestler. He won the silver medal in the men's 74 kg event at the 2021 European Wrestling Championships held in Warsaw, Poland.[1][2]

He competed in the 74 kg event at the 2022 World Wrestling Championships held in Belgrade, Serbia.[3]

Kirov competed at the 2024 European Wrestling Olympic Qualification Tournament in Baku, Azerbaijan hoping to qualify for the 2024 Summer Olympics in Paris, France.[4] He was eliminated in his third match and he did not qualify for the Olympics.[4]
